View Game3 View Game68%Game Brain Scoregameplay, musicreplayability, stability68% User Score 943 reviewsCritic Score 65%1 reviews"8BitBoy" is a single-player platformer game with a nostalgic 80s and 90s vibe, offering approximately 12 hours of main story playtime. The game features 5 worlds, 56 levels, and over 300 hidden locations to explore, with a variety of power-ups and boss battles. The game follows the journey of 8BitBoy, who gets sucked into a decaying world of platforming through a strange cartridge he found in his basement.

View Game6 View Game85%Game Brain Scorehumor, gameplaystability, optimization91% User Score 4,467 reviewsCritic Score 79%21 reviewsIn "Trover Saves the Universe," you control a Chairorpian worker whose dogs are abducted by a maniacal bird. Tasked with rescuing your canine companions, you join forces with Trover, a purple eye-hole monster. Together, you navigate through a variety of strange and humorous dimensions to save the universe and your beloved dogs.
